Exploring Pedagogical Approaches: A Comparative Analysis Of Information Delivery Methods In Fish Dissection Instruction, Kiara Smidt
Honors Projects
The Covid-19 pandemic prompted a global shift to remote work and education, challenging traditional teaching methods. This research explores the effectiveness of audiovisual versus visual-only guides in teaching perch dissection anatomy, safety, and procedure. The study involves a cross-sectional experiment with students from an Introduction to Biology course at Bowling Green State University. Participants were divided into groups using either a video or a written guide, and their knowledge was assessed before and after the dissection. Results calculated through a Student’s t-test indicate no significant difference in overall effectiveness between the two methods, apart from labeling an anatomy diagram and …

The Impact Of Teacher Preparedness And Professional Development On Fourth-Grade Students' Science Achievement, Craig L. Mayo, Faye Bradley
The Impact Of Teacher Preparedness And Professional Development On Fourth-Grade Students' Science Achievement, Craig L. Mayo, Faye Bradley
Journal of Research Initiatives
Science scores among US fourth-grade students have declined compared to their international counterparts in recent years. Recent results show that teachers are the most impactful influence on student success and accountability. Teacher preparedness and professional development are two key areas that serve as indicators of providing relevant and essential information for students' success. A correlational quantitative study was conducted to assess the relationship between teacher preparedness and professional development on fourth-grade students’ science achievement. The TIMSS 2019 data were secured from the Boston College, TIMSS, and PIRLS International websites. The data was evaluated using the SPSS 27 Hierarchical Linear Regression. …
The Sci – Dot: A New Dimension Of Scientific Innovation For Persons With Blv., Ashley N. Nashleanas Ph.D.
The Sci – Dot: A New Dimension Of Scientific Innovation For Persons With Blv., Ashley N. Nashleanas Ph.D.
Journal of Science Education for Students with Disabilities
Throughout history, students with blindness and low vision (BLV) have been vastly underrepresented in science, technology, engineering, and mathematics (STEM) disciplines with regards to both K-12 education and post-secondary endeavors (Burgstahler, 1994; Supalo, 2010). This underrepresentation of students with BLV in STEM is due to limitations in technology that allow them to access data in a laboratory setting, thus inhibiting their abilities to partake actively in data acquisition with their peers. The Sci-Dot, a multiline, refreshable braille and tactile graphics display capable of logging scientific data in real time with the support of Vernier Science Education’s (VSE) Go-Direct Bluetooth sensors, …

Supporting Black Students In Sixth-Grade Science Through A Social Constructivist Approach: A Mixed-Methods Action Research Study, Kirk Anthony Heath
Supporting Black Students In Sixth-Grade Science Through A Social Constructivist Approach: A Mixed-Methods Action Research Study, Kirk Anthony Heath
Theses and Dissertations
The purpose of this mixed-method action research study was to improve Black students’ performance in my sixth-grade science class by improving their ability to use the claim, evidence, and reasoning (CER) framework. Using criterion-based convenient sampling, I enlisted 17 Black participants, all of whom were underperforming in my science class at a suburban, middle-class, predominantly White public middle school serving Grades 6–8. As a teacher researcher, I implemented and assessed an intervention designed to improve their ability to use the CER framework. Using a mixed-method action research design, I simultaneously collected and triangulated quantitative and qualitative data.

Child Science Identity Interview Guide And Protocol, Heidi Cian, Remy Dou
Child Science Identity Interview Guide And Protocol, Heidi Cian, Remy Dou
Department of Teaching and Learning
While many data collection tools exist to elicit how individuals think about prototypical STEM persons (e.g., the Draw-a-Scientist assessment), such tools fail to capture the nuance of how individuals think about STEM and STEM personhood and how those perceptions change according to context and “in real life”. We designed the Child Science Identity Interview Guide and Protocol to learn about how youth see everyday experiences as “STEM” (or a particular subfield) and think of themselves and those in their social orbits as STEM persons.

Designing And Implementing A Novel Graduate Program To Develop Transdisciplinary Leaders In Urban Sustainability, Megan M. Wallen, Ingrid Guerra-Lopez, Louay Meroueh, Rayman Mohamed, Andrea Sankar, Pradeep Sopory, Ryan Watkins, Donna R. Kashian
Designing And Implementing A Novel Graduate Program To Develop Transdisciplinary Leaders In Urban Sustainability, Megan M. Wallen, Ingrid Guerra-Lopez, Louay Meroueh, Rayman Mohamed, Andrea Sankar, Pradeep Sopory, Ryan Watkins, Donna R. Kashian
Biological Sciences Faculty Research Publications
Urban settings, where >50% of the world's population resides, are increasingly faced with environmental challenges that threaten their sustainability. Aging infrastructure, water and air pollution, and increasing recognition of environmental injustices highlight the need for professionals to employ complex scientific reasoning across disciplines where they can effectively address the multifaceted issues of urban sustainability. Here we present an innovative model for preparing the next generation of public, private, and academic leaders to address complex problems in urban sustainability. Specifically, we outline the design and implementation of an integrated, adaptable graduate training program, with the goals of science leadership, curriculum relevancy, …

Growing Capacity In Gifted And Talented Education Through Science, Technology, Engineering, Arts, And Mathematics (Steam), Sheron Mark, Chin-Wen Jean Lee, Peter A. Azmani
Growing Capacity In Gifted And Talented Education Through Science, Technology, Engineering, Arts, And Mathematics (Steam), Sheron Mark, Chin-Wen Jean Lee, Peter A. Azmani
Kentucky Teacher Education Journal: The Journal of the Teacher Education Division of the Kentucky Council for Exceptional Children
A graduate-level gifted and talented education (GTE) course for in-service teachers was revised aiming to prepare teachers to integrate science, technology, engineering, arts, and mathematics (STEAM) education into existing curricula to create challenging learning experiences for students identified as gifted and talented. Two university-based teacher educators in science education and GTE, respectively, engaged in action research in order to develop and refine a semester-long STEAM project in the GTE course to accomplish this goal. In all, two elementary, one Music, and one World History teacher participated. Case study analysis explored the teachers’ approaches to developing STEAM-based lessons to expand their …

Gaining Access To The Language Of Science: A Research Partnership For Disciplined, Discursive Ways To Select And Assess Vocabulary Knowledge, H. Emily Hayden, Anupma Singh, Michelle Eades Baird
Gaining Access To The Language Of Science: A Research Partnership For Disciplined, Discursive Ways To Select And Assess Vocabulary Knowledge, H. Emily Hayden, Anupma Singh, Michelle Eades Baird
Reading Horizons: A Journal of Literacy and Language Arts
To equalize access to science learning across genders and demographic groups, access to the disciplinary language of science is one place to start. The language of science is highly challenging and specialized, and difficulties acquiring this language contribute to disparities in science achievement across diverse student groups. This study used a pre-post design to analyze effectiveness of a brief classroom science vocabulary assessment designed to assess receptive and productive vocabulary knowledge across multiple sections of one 7th grade science teacher’s class. Vocabulary was selected and analysis conducted by an interdisciplinary research partnership including the science teacher, a literacy specialist, …
Students With Visual Impairments' Access And Participation In The Science Curriculum: Views Of Teachers Of Students With Visual Impairments, Karen E. Koehler, Tiffany A. Wild
Students With Visual Impairments' Access And Participation In The Science Curriculum: Views Of Teachers Of Students With Visual Impairments, Karen E. Koehler, Tiffany A. Wild
Journal of Science Education for Students with Disabilities
Science is a core curricular area of instruction for all students and the federal mandates of the Individuals with Disabilities Education Act (2004) and No Child Left Behind (2001) require that students with disabilities are educated in the least restrictive environment and have access to general education science content, based upon rigorous standards. While, most students with visual impairments are educated in the general science classroom, few studies have been done to determine whether appropriate accommodations and modifications are being made in those classrooms to meet the specialized needs of these students. Teaching Science Through Inquiry Based Field Experiences Using Orientation And Mobility, Danene K. Fast, Tiffany A. Wild
Teaching Science Through Inquiry Based Field Experiences Using Orientation And Mobility, Danene K. Fast, Tiffany A. Wild
Journal of Science Education for Students with Disabilities
Instruction in science can be difficult for students with visual impairments due to the use of visual instruction that is often used for conceptual understanding. Pedagogical approaches to teaching science continue to evolve, with inquiry-based science instruction as a primary instructional method used in current classrooms.
In teaching students with visual impairments, inquiry is a strategy that has been traditionally been used in orientation and mobility (O&M) instruction, in an effort to teach students with vision loss to explore and make conclusions about their environments through the use of all senses.

Elementary Students’ Attitudes Toward Social Studies, Math, And Science: An Analysis With The Emphasis On Social Studies, Sahin Dundar, Anatoli Rapoport
Elementary Students’ Attitudes Toward Social Studies, Math, And Science: An Analysis With The Emphasis On Social Studies, Sahin Dundar, Anatoli Rapoport
The Councilor: A National Journal of the Social Studies
The purpose of the study was to compare upper elementary students' attitudes towards social studies, science, math, and to find out whether there si a significant difference between 4th and 5th grade students' attitudes towards social studies. The participants of the study were 4th and 5th grades students (n=348) from three elementary schools in a Midwestern state. Results showed that students held less positive attitudes towards social studies than science and mathematics, and fourth graders hold more positive attitues toward social studies than fifth graders.
